Hydrophobic coating

Hydrophobic coatings help in removing spots and dirt from surfaces such as metal, glass, and plastic. They can also protect these surfaces from moisture damage and increase their durability. They are typically used on outdoor surfaces and they can help reduce the time required to clean and also cost. They also can help to prevent rust and corrosion, and they may even provide UV protection.

Hydrophobic paints are smooth surfaces that repel water molecules. These coatings are usually made from fluoropolymers, including pol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), better known as Teflon. These substances have a high lubricity as well as a slippery feel. They can be used on glass, metals and textiles. The manufacturers determine the hydrophobicity of a substance by putting a droplet on its surface and measuring the contact angle. Super-hydrophobic coatings have a contact angle of more than 150 degrees.

A hydrophobic coating for your windshield can be a great addition to any vehicle. It will prevent fogging and decrease the necessity for windshield wipers, which improves visibility and ensure safety. It can also be used in rainy conditions to reduce the need for windshield wipers.

A hydrophobic coating is also able to resist mold and mildew. This type of coating could be particularly useful in humid environments where fungal growth may cause problems. A hydrophobic coating could last for up to ten years, which can reduce the cost of maintenance.

Safe windows

While the majority of the security industry focuses on doors and locks, burglars are also able to gain access through windows. Two out of three burglaries that occur in America involve a window.

There are a variety of ways you can make your windows more secure. For instance, you can install window bars, which prevent a burglar from entering your home through windows and are available in a variety of designs. They offer privacy without affecting your view.

Installing tempered glass is an alternative option. This is stronger and more secure than ordinary annealed glass. When glass that is tempered breaks, it shatters into smaller, relatively harmless fragments, rather than sharp dangerous shards. This kind of glass helps to reduce the likelihood of injury from broken windows particularly during an emergency or break-in.

Replacement windows with security features can enhance the safety of a home. They could have hinges that are more difficult to open than traditional hinges, reducing the possibility of burglars gaining entry through windows. They could be constructed with one frame that is more durable and stronger to withstand being broken or pushed open.

Complete window replacement

You can boost the energy efficiency of your home and its curb appeal by replacing all of your windows. You can upgrade your windows to better quality units with insulated glass and advanced window films. These technologies help reduce energy loss and transfer and reduce your cooling and heating costs. They are also easier to maintain and maintain. You can also choose from a wide range of color options and features to improve the appearance of the windows you are getting.

Full frame replacement is more costly than insert replacement, but it's usually worth the investment. The process involves removing both the exterior and interior trim as well as installing the replacement window. This allows for thorough inspections and repairs which can reduce the risk of moisture intrusion that may have accumulated over time from the old window.
